The upgrade process -will require you to rebuild everything linked to -libmysqlclient.so.16 and libmysqlclient_r.so.16. - -This may be done for you by portage with 'emerge @preserved-rebuild'. - -A small number of libraries may not be automatically rebuilt against -the new MySQL libraries using preserved-rebuild. If you have -difficulties with packages not finding the new libraries, install -app-portage/gentoolkit and run: -# revdep-rebuild --library libmysqlclient.so.16 -# revdep-rebuild --library libmysqlclient_r.so.16 - -The official upgrade documentation is available here: -http://dev.mysql.com/doc/refman/5.5/en/upgrading.html - -Please be sure to review the upgrade document for any possible actions -necessary before and after the upgrade. This includes running -mysql_upgrade after the upgrade completion. - -Due to security flaws, MySQL 5.1 will be hard masked in 30 days after -this news item is posted.
